My microsoft usb opti mouse is diconnecting and reconnecting itself. It
makes the noise you hear when doing so physically with a usb device.
Its a standard mouse I think and can't figure out what it is. The
clicks also stop working and then start again, but pauses can be up to
minutes meaning I have to unplug it from the back and then reconnect. I
dont think its drivers because I have already downloaded mouse drivers
and they did'nt help. is it the usb port or the mouse itself?

Could be a problem with the mouse cable or the connectors.

Also, I use Properties for some USB devices in Device Manager and disable
"turn off device to save power".
